Aozora Art: Blue Sky Art 30th Anniversary!(Peek-a-boo Art project)

  

2024 is the 30th anniversary of Aozora Art(Blue Sky Art/ Peek-a-boo Art project, which started in August 1994.

Is this really art? I started this interactive art project with the participation of passersby, although I was wondering if it was art or not.

It is an art project that asks not art fans but “passers-by” questions such as what family is, what marriage is, and what gender is. The name “social practice” is now attached to this genre of art project.

If you were something/someone other than yourself, how would you feel and how would things be different from the way you are now? It is a basic concept form that invites people to imagine this.

Photo: August 28, 1994

This is the Harajuku pedestrian street, Aozora Art(Blue Sky Art/ Peek-a-boo Art project, for the second time, maybe.

I remember we held the first season of the art project at Omotesando side of Harajuku.

The artist asked passersby to “Create your ideal family, and get a commemorative photo!” Participants choosed their favorite family members on a family sheet, and a “Peek-a-boo board” to match each family member. Then, we took their family photo with an instant film camera. The participant was asked to sign the photo as a family member on the spot. One photo is given away and one was kept to us for preservation.

This “family menber” was almost a replica of the actual composition of grandparents, parents, and sisters. And they actually took a picture of them with their faces out of that roll's Peek-a-boo boards.

Peekaboo-kun Interactive Sculptures Show at The New York Botanical Garden

Hi!I installed six Peekaboo-kun Sculptures for Mothers’ day weekend, Sat. 12th and Sun. 13th May.
I was asked to create a new Tulip Peekaboo-kun. It was first time to me to make three holes on the same painting, and it was very fun!
One other thing for my first challenge was light weights small sized inclusive Peekaboo-kun.It allows having fun for wheelchair users, people who has difficulty to stick their faces to regular Peekaboo-kun. These Sculptures were planed to be displayed beside The Conservatory, however because of spring rain, they were set under a roof of Leon Levy Visitor Center. I was very happy almost visitors enjoyed the art show. Especially there were many elderly moms sitting on wheel chairs also enjoyed the inclusive art with their families.

“Aliens in New York” project is an audience participatory public art which I started the art style in Harajuku Tokyo since 1994. I have poured my art life to the project. The aim is to provide art experience to community, being and imagine transforming to other people using Peekaboo-board art devices, promoting mutual understandings among different ethnicities, religions, races, genders, and other social standings, and making better life, place and future.

119 people participated to four time workshops, and more than 5000 people enjoyed the Aliens in New York art project, and 10 volunteer staff worked with me in 2015. Please give me more opportunity to distribute the art project to many people with your support.
